The Intel Core i7 14700K leads in gaming performance with a score of 83, thanks to its excellent single-core performance. Its higher score gives it the edge in this use case.
The Intel Core i7 14700K excels in creative workloads with a score of 78, largely due to its capable multi-core performance and high core count. This makes it the clear winner in this use case.
Both CPUs have similar power efficiency scores, with the Intel Core i7 14700K scoring 58 and the Intel Core i9 13900HK scoring 57. This makes them effectively tied in this use case.
